DEV Community

Cover image for Beyond the Dashboard: Building Data Trust in Ecommerce Operations
EShopSet
EShopSet

Posted on

Beyond the Dashboard: Building Data Trust in Ecommerce Operations

You’ve meticulously crafted a stunning dashboard, a seamless reporting system, or an elegant integration for an ecommerce client. The user interface is flawless, the data flows (mostly), and everyone appears satisfied during the project kickoff. Yet, weeks later, the client quietly reverts to their familiar spreadsheets. The underlying issue? Despite its polish, the new system lacks the fundamental element that truly matters: trust in the accuracy of the data.

This precise scenario recently emerged in a compelling community discussion that captured our attention. A seasoned project manager, the original poster, shared a profound insight from an ERP project: building the dashboard itself was not the primary challenge; convincing people to trust the data it presented was. They detailed a series of common obstacles that will undoubtedly resonate with any ecommerce agency:

  • Machine readings (or system events) arriving late

  • Reliance on manual data entry for critical fields

  • Operators skipping fields under pressure (e.g., during peak order fulfillment)

  • Inventory numbers not matching physical stock or storefront availability

  • Different teams using different 'sources of truth' for the same metric

  • Reports looking clean despite incomplete or inaccurate source data

  • The gap between managers' desire for real-time visibility and the actual process's capabilities

This challenge profoundly impacts the world of ecommerce agencies. Whether you’re configuring a new analytics platform, migrating product data for a store relaunch, integrating a new payment gateway with HubSpot Commerce, or developing custom reporting for a client’s HubSpot CRM and Sales Hub, data quality forms the essential foundation. If this base is unstable, the entire structure—from inventory management to customer segmentation, marketing automation, and RevOps reporting—can collapse, undermining client confidence and project success.

Detailed examination of data for accuracy and governance, symbolizing the importance of robust data quality checks and documentation in ecommerce operations.Detailed examination of data for accuracy and governance, symbolizing the importance of robust data quality checks and documentation in ecommerce operations.## Beyond the Screen: Redefining Acceptance Criteria

The original poster astutely noted that if acceptance criteria merely state 'display production report' or 'construct inventory dashboard,' the work can be technically delivered without actually fulfilling the core business requirement. The true criteria, they argued, should address the fundamental data integrity and user confidence. These crucial considerations include:

  • What is the definitive source of truth for each key data point?

  • How are missing data points handled and communicated?

  • What's the protocol for late data and its impact on reporting?

  • Who has the authority to override numbers, and what's the audit trail?

  • What gets flagged for review, and by whom?

  • Which reports can be marked final, and what confidence level is needed before a recommendation is shown?

A community member reinforced this perspective, emphasizing that successful teams establish data ownership and exception workflows before commencing any development. This proactive strategy prevents the common pitfall of delivering dashboards where 'nobody agrees on what ‘production count’ even means or who gets to fix bad entries.'

Data Governance: The Unsung Hero of Delivery Operations

Another contributor highlighted the necessity for explicit milestones and requirements related to data governance and data readiness. Their proposed acceptance criteria would encompass validations with specialized data governance tools, clear benchmarks for data maturity, and a repeatable scoring system to assess data quality and accuracy. Examples of this approach could include:

  • A data readiness score of 80% with no data gaps for critical fields (e.g., SKU, price, customer email).

  • A data governance score of 90% with key fields set as mandatory and using dropdown menus rather than free text.

  • A reduction in text fields to zero for all fields/columns used in analytics and dashboards.

  • A validated and approved data dictionary and catalog with an assigned data steward for continued maintenance.

For ecommerce agencies, integrating such rigorous data governance into your delivery playbooks is absolutely essential. It transforms abstract data quality concerns into concrete, measurable deliverables, ensuring that every project contributes to a robust data ecosystem instead of merely producing another isolated report.

Building Trust: Practical Steps for Agencies and Developers

So, how can ecommerce agencies and developers ensure that the data powering their client’s operations—from the storefront to RevOps—is not only present but also deeply trusted?

1. Define Data Ownership & Source of Truth Early

Prior to initiating any development, collaborate with clients to clearly establish who owns specific data sets and what constitutes the definitive 'source of truth' for critical metrics. For instance, is HubSpot CRM the primary source for customer contact information, or is it an external ERP? Is product inventory managed within the ecommerce platform or a separate WMS? This clarity prevents conflicting reports and cultivates confidence.

2. Establish Robust Data Governance Protocols

Implement comprehensive processes for data entry validation (e.g., mandatory fields, dropdowns preferred over free text), exception handling, and data reconciliation. Document these procedures within a thorough implementation artifacts library that can be leveraged across multiple projects. This includes defining how late data is managed and who possesses the authority to override numbers, as suggested by the original poster. Such protocols are vital for preserving the integrity of data flowing into and out of systems like HubSpot Commerce.

3. Integrate Data Quality into Acceptance Criteria

Shift the focus beyond 'does the report display?' to 'is the data within the report sufficiently trusted to inform business decisions?' Incorporate specific metrics for data completeness, accuracy, and timeliness. For example, 'Order fulfillment status in the HubSpot Sales Hub must precisely match the shipping carrier data with 99% accuracy, updated every 30 minutes.'

4. Proactive Communication & Data Lineage

As one community member observed, 'if they spot one tiny discrepancy... the entire dashboard is suddenly 'broken' in their eyes forever.' Communicate data lineage extensively—explaining where data originates, how it is transformed, and its inherent limitations. Transparency fosters trust, particularly when integrating complex systems or migrating data.

5. Leverage Tools for Data Validation

Utilize EShopSet’s capabilities for seamlessly integrating and validating data across various platforms such as HubSpot CRM, Commerce, and other operational tools. Implement automated checks and alerts for data discrepancies, making it easier to pinpoint and correct issues before they undermine trust. This is fundamental for maintaining a healthy RevOps ecosystem.

6. Address the Human Element

Occasionally, distrust isn't solely rooted in technical issues; it can stem from a perceived negative reflection on a team or resistance to change. Engage stakeholders early, articulate the benefits of accurate data, and involve them in defining metrics and resolving discrepancies. This collaborative approach helps overcome resistance and nurtures a culture of data-driven decision-making.

In the dynamic world of ecommerce, reliable data serves as the lifeblood for effective operations and strategic decision-making. For agencies, delivering solutions that are not only functional but also deeply trusted by clients represents the ultimate measure of success. By prioritizing data quality, robust governance, and transparent communication from the outset, you can ensure that your meticulously crafted dashboards and integrations evolve into indispensable tools, genuinely empowering your clients’ growth.

Top comments (0)